HISTORY AND VALUES
Halo Family Services was founded with a simple yet powerful belief: no one should face life’s struggles alone. Our journey began when a group of mental health professionals, social workers, and community advocates recognized a gap in accessible, holistic care for individuals and families in crisis. Witnessing the challenges faced by underserved communities, they came together to create a comprehensive support network that addresses mental health, family stability, and social well-being.
Since our founding, Halo Family Services has grown into a trusted organization offering a wide range of services, from counseling and crisis intervention to women’s health resources and youth development programs. Our commitment to providing personalized, compassionate care continues to drive our mission forward, ensuring that every individual who walks through our doors receives the support they deserve.

Partners & Collaborations
Halo Family Services is proud to collaborate with a network of organizations dedicated to mental health, women’s support, and community development. Our key partners include:
Hope Haven Domestic Violence Shelter – A safe haven providing emergency housing and legal advocacy for survivors of domestic violence
Community Health Alliance – Offering free and low-cost healthcare services, including mental health support for underserved populations
Youth Rising Initiative – A mentorship and leadership program empowering young people to achieve their full potential
Women’s Empowerment Network – Partnering to provide job training, financial literacy, and career advancement programs for women in need
